COLUMBUS, Ohio — As the Ohio State Buckeyes left the field trailing 14-3 at halftime on Saturday, their fans really let them hear it.

By the end of the game, those boos had turned to cheers.

Devon Torrence tipped and snagged an interception and returned it 34 yards for the go-ahead touchdown, and the Buckeyes (No. 9 BCS, No. 8 AP) ran off the final 35 points for a 38-14 win.

“We know how much our fans are obsessed with Ohio State football,” said wide receiver Dane Sanzenbacher, who caught a ricochet off a defender for a quirky 58-yard score in the 21-0 fourth quarter. “Booing us? I probably would have booed us.”
